A rounded, monoline sans with softly squared terminals and gently irregular, hand-drawn–like curvature. Counters are open and generous, with circular and elliptical bowls that keep a light, airy color on the page. Proportions feel slightly expanded, with simple, uncluttered forms and minimal stroke modulation; joins are smooth and corners are eased rather than sharp. Numerals follow the same simple geometry, with clear, open shapes and a consistent, lightly constructed rhythm.
Works well for branding and packaging that benefits from a warm, approachable feel, as well as posters and short headlines where its open shapes can stay crisp. It also suits children’s media and lighthearted editorial accents, especially at medium to large sizes where the delicate construction remains comfortable to read.
The overall tone is friendly and informal, reading as approachable rather than technical. Its soft geometry and relaxed shapes give it a playful, conversational voice while still staying clean enough for contemporary branding.
The design appears intended to deliver a simple, modern sans with softened geometry and an inviting personality. It prioritizes openness, clarity, and a gentle rhythm to create an easygoing display and text companion for friendly communications.
Round letters like O, C, and G emphasize smooth, continuous curves, and the lowercase maintains an easy, readable flow in text settings. The punctuation and spacing in the sample text suggest a design aimed at a light, spacious texture rather than dense paragraph color.
